In the last 20 years, the textile industry has been able to increase its production by as much as 400%. However, it also becomes apparent that the whole industry has its problems, many of which can be solved by following the SDGs outlined by the UN. Our team aims to introduce a new, sustainable approach to textile production by addressing these aspects: 1. Sustainable materials 2. Proper waste management 3. Productive efficiency We seek to lend support to developing countries by launching a self-sufficient waste management and hemp textile production system in which the amount of resources used are minimized by recycling and reusing the production waste. Our recycling centers located outside megacities, near slums, are supposed to reduce the amount of waste dumped in the landfills by using advanced recycling techniques such as Neu Pulp recycling. The leftovers (water and gas) are used to optimize the hemp textile production with the steam explosion method, which not only improves the quality of the textile, but also reduces the labor intensity. The reduction in costs makes the production more accessible to the customers, allowing for bigger changes in the market to be achieved.
